“Dallas’ Spanish-language news station Telemundo’s KXTX-TV (Channel 39) is bracing for job cuts and major changes after parent company NBC Universal announced dramatic cost-cutting measures earlier this week.
The media company said it plans to cut 700 jobs throughout its television operations nationally in order to trim operating expenses by $750 million by the end of the year.”
